Stryker is currently seeking a Clinical Specialist to join our Joint Replacement team based in Darwin, NT
This is a casual role is primarily during the business days, with occasional on-call, and weekend work to support urgent cases.
Key responsibilities:
Provide clinical and technical support during orthopaedic procedures, primarily in hip and knee replacement
Build strong, trusted relationships with surgeons, nurses, and other healthcare professionals
Deliver ongoing training and education to hospital staff on the effective use of Stryker products
Collaborate with the sales team to support territory objectives and case planning
Maintain up-to-date knowledge of product offerings and clinical techniques
Ensure exceptional service and support to both public and private hospitals across Darwin
What we’re looking for:
Tertiary qualification in a relevant field (e.g. nursing, physiotherapy, science, biomedical engineering)
Strong communication and interpersonal skills
Ability to thrive in a fast-paced, theatre-based environment
Excellent attention to detail and problem-solving abilities
Previous experience in a clinical or healthcare setting is advantageous
Current driver’s license and flexibility to travel as required

Stryker is a global leader in medical technologies and, together with our customers, we are driven to make healthcare better. We offer innovative products and services in MedSurg, Neurotechnology and Orthopaedics that help improve patient and healthcare outcomes. Alongside its customers around the world, Stryker impacts more than 150 million patients annually. More information is available at stryker.com and careers.stryker.com.
Facts:
● 2024 Sales: $22.6 billion
● Industry: Medical Instruments & Supplies
● Employees: 53,000 worldwide
● 40 years of sales growth leading up to 2020
● 44+ Manufacturing and R&D Locations Worldwide
● $1.5 billion spent on research and development in 2024
● ~14,200 patents owned globally in 2024
● Products sold in ~75 countries
● Fortune 500 Company
● 7 consecutive years as one of Fortune's World's Best Workplaces
